Yale releases new statement regarding Cahill investigation

Yale University Associate Athletic Director and Director of Sports Publicity Steve Conn released a new statement this afternoon regarding Chris Cahill’s eligibility: The NCAA has confirmed the process and due diligence of Yale University and the Ivy League regarding the eligibility of Chris Cahill.
